MAA Issues COVID-19 Response and 2020 Guidance Update


GERMANTOWN, Tenn., March 24, 2020 /PRNewswire/ -- Mid-America Apartment Communities, Inc., or MAA (NYSE: MAA), today issued a statement regarding the company's response to the COVID-19 pandemic.

"The health and wellbeing of our residents, associates and all who visit our properties are MAA's highest priority," said Eric Bolton, Chairman and Chief Executive Officer.  "We are actively monitoring updates from the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ention and complying with state and local orders aimed at slowing the spread of the novel coronavirus by limiting physical contact." Bolton added, "Our regional and corporate associates are working remotely and our leasing offices, although closed to the public, are functioning virtually to both assist new customers and support our current residents.  Efforts are underway to provide flexibility on April payments with residents who are financially impacted by the pandemic."

Chief Financial Officer Al Campbell reported: "We expect first quarter 2020 results to be in-line with our previously announced guidance.  Year to date through March 24, 2020, average daily physical occupancy for our same store portfolio is solid at 95.7%.  Our balance sheet remains very strong, with low leverage, significant capacity from undrawn committed credit facilities, and limited near-term debt maturities and funding obligations.  However, as we face uncertainty regarding the economic effects of the pandemic, we are withdrawing our full year 2020 guidance and will update our expectations when we report our first quarter 2020 results on April 29, 2020."
